DJ Spider and DJ Dynamix
After a holiday break, DJ Spider returns to speak with DJ Dynamix on the Beatsource‘s The 20 Podcast. The episode was recorded at Beatsource’s new headquarters in Los Angeles.
Dynamix is an award-winning DJ and turntablist from Los Angeles. He’s a former five-time Red Bull 3Style US finalist and finalist on VH1’s Master of the Mix show. When he’s not rocking clubs around the world or battling, Dynamix serves as an instructor at the Beat Junkie Institute of Sound DJ school in Los Angeles.

‘R.O.A.D. Podcast’: DJ Dynamix Recalls When His Laptop Crashed at Red Bull 3Style
On this week’s R.O.A.D. Podcast, the crew talks to renowned party rocker, DJ Dynamix. The Los Angeles DJ shares his experience at last year’s Red Bull 3Style finals in Philadelphia when his laptop crashed in the middle of his performance.
The three-time Red Bull 3Style regional champion, also discusses his process for preparing routines for competitions and the expectations clubs have of him after his success in the battle scene.

DJ Dynamix Launches Visual Mixtape Series, ‘Open Format Fridays’
DJ Dynamix performs at Aurea Vista Nightclub in Riverside, California on March 9, 2018. (Source: Aurea Vista)
DJ Dynamix has launched Open Format Fridays, a visual mixtape series in which he’ll showcase his turntablist-friendly mixes on video.
The three-time Red Bull Music 3Style Los Angeles champion described the series on Instagram:
“[I’ll] go through different themes and genres and try to tell a story through the music. I’ll be incorporating new and old mixing techniques and implement some of the newer features in the DJ technology world. This first episode is Top 40. Just wanted to do something everyone can understand.”
In the first episode, Dynamix takes viewers on a 10-minute journey through a variety of popular hits. He weaves together a few different themes using creative word play and tone play transitions.

DJ OBSCENE and DJ Dynamix Perform a Routine Using Pioneer DJ’s DJM-S3
DJ OBSCENE and DJ Dynamix stopped by DJcity’s office in Los Angeles to play around with Pioneer DJ’s new two-channel mixer, the DJM-S3. The former Red Bull 3Style champions ended up putting together a routine and performing it for us.

Watch ‘Off the Beat and Path’ Feat. DJ Dynamix
After a six-month hiatus, DJcityTV’s Off the Beat and Path series is back with a second video. On this episode, DJ Dynamix hikes three miles to the summit of Echo Mountain in Los Angeles for a portable scratch session. Dynamix is a three-time Red Bull Thre3style Los Angeles Champion and was a contestant on season three of VH1’s Master of the Mix.
Track: Four Color Zack – After the Laughter
Equipment: Numark PT01 turntable, Mixfader, edjing Scratch app, iPhone 6, V-MODA headphones, JetPack Slim Backpack

Listen to Dynamix’s Mix for the DJcity Podcast
DJ Dynamix at the 2015 Red Bull Thre3style Regional Qualifier in San Diego, California. (Erik Voake)
This week’s DJcity Podcast is served up by three-time Red Bull Thre3style Regional Champion, Dynamix. His 30-minute set features primarily new hip-hop and twerk along with a couple house and moombahton tracks. Aside from showing off his scratching skills, the Los Angeles native also includes blends and word play in the mix.
